We’ve had an incredible response to our cycle rides and picnics this term! Pupils have loved the chance to get out and about, breathe in some fresh air, and enjoy a healthy break from their usual routine. It’s been fantastic to see students socialising with peers they don’t normally interact with, building new friendships and confidence along the way.

A huge thank you to our amazing Engagement Team for organising everything so seamlessly—and to the dedicated staff volunteers who’ve come along, rain or shine, to make each outing special. Your support has truly made a difference.

It has combined the benefits of physical activity with the power of connection and encouragement; a way to build relationships, promote wellbeing, and enjoy the outdoors together.

Cycling is not only fun but incredibly good for body and mind. From boosting heart health to improving mood, balance, and sleep, the benefits are endless.
